提交 91c565bc 作者: han

帖子评论回复

上级 e23586b3
流水线 #8371 已通过 于阶段
in 2 分 58 秒
......@@ -445,7 +445,7 @@ public class RequirementsController extends BaseController {
public ResultBody adminAgreeOrder(HttpServletRequest request,
@ApiParam(value = "派单id") @RequestParam Integer requireId,
@ApiParam(value = "确认状态:1同意,2不同意") @RequestParam Integer status) {
return requirementsService.orderConfirmationByTeam(requireId,status,this.getUserLoginInfoFromRedis(request).getToken());
return requirementsService. orderConfirmationByTeam(requireId,status,this.getUserLoginInfoFromRedis(request).getToken());
}
}
......@@ -12,6 +12,8 @@ import javax.annotation.Resource;
import javax.servlet.http.HttpServletRequest;
import com.mmc.csf.common.util.redis.RedisConstant;
import com.mmc.csf.infomation.dto.UserBaseInfoDTO;
import com.mmc.csf.release.util.SmsUtil;
import lombok.extern.slf4j.Slf4j;
import org.apache.commons.collections4.CollectionUtils;
import org.springframework.beans.factory.annotation.Autowired;
......@@ -275,6 +277,10 @@ public class DynamicServiceImpl implements DynamicService {
dynamicDao.insertforumFirstLevelReview(forumFirstLevelReviewDO);
// 修改评论数量
dynamicDao.updateDynamicCommentCount(commentVO.getDynamicId(), forumDynamicDO.getVersion());
UserBaseInfoDTO user1 = userAppApi.feignGetUserBaseInfo(forumDynamicDO.getUserAccountId());
UserBaseInfoDTO user2 = userAppApi.feignGetUserBaseInfo(forumFirstLevelReviewDO.getUserAccountId());
SmsUtil.sendCommentDynamic(user1.getPhoneNum());
SmsUtil.sendCommentDynamic(user2.getPhoneNum());
return ResultBody.success();
} else {
return resultBody;
......
......@@ -35,6 +35,8 @@ public class SmsUtil {
private static String COOPERATION_TEMPLATE_PASS_CODE_10="SMS_464371178";
private static String COOPERATION_TEMPLATE_PASS_CODE_11="SMS_464371179";
private static String COOPERATION_TEMPLATE_PASS_CODE_12="SMS_464321248";
private static String COOPERATION_TEMPLATE_PASS_CODE_13="SMS_465375237";
//短信验证码模板
private static String VERIFYCODE="SMS_211825548";
......@@ -82,6 +84,10 @@ public class SmsUtil {
return send(CLOUD_JOIN_WEBSITE, COOPERATION_TEMPLATE_PASS_CODE_12, null, phone);
}
//评论动态短信提醒
public static String sendCommentDynamic(String phone) {
return send(CLOUD_JOIN_WEBSITE, COOPERATION_TEMPLATE_PASS_CODE_12, null, phone);
}
public static String send(String TemplateCode, String param, String phone) {
return send(CLOUD_JOIN_WEBSITE, TemplateCode, param, phone);
}
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论